Runway Capability

6562 feet of runway at Varkaus Airport supports light jets through most super-midsize jets. Aircraft like the Phenom 300, Citation XLS, Challenger 350, and Gulfstream G280 operate comfortably from EFVR. Heavy jets (Gulfstream G550/G650, Global Express) require performance calculations accounting for temperature, weight, and field elevation before committing to this runway length.

Operational Considerations

Varkaus Airport's 286-foot field elevation keeps density altitude effects manageable. Even on warm days, density altitude here tops out around 2,086 feet — within normal performance parameters for most aircraft. The 6,562-foot runway provides approximately 6,506 feet of effective sea-level performance.

Varkaus Airport's high latitude brings extreme seasonal variation to flight operations. Winter days in this region may provide only 6-8 hours of usable daylight. Runway contamination from snow and ice is expected from November through March. Icing conditions — both structural and induction — are a persistent hazard during the cold months. Summer operations benefit from extended twilight or near-continuous daylight, expanding the operational window significantly. Fog formation is common during seasonal transitions as temperature and moisture patterns shift.
